abbr标签的主要用途是为缩写词提供完整解释,通过title属性在鼠标悬停时显示,提升可访问性和语义化;2. 它对屏幕阅读器用户尤为重要,能确保缩写词被正确朗读,避免理解障碍;3. 相比已废弃的acronym标签,html5统一使用abbr标签表示所有缩写,简化语义结构;4. 实际开发中应为abbr添加title属性,并用css添加下划线和帮助光标以提示交互;5. 常见缩写如“mr.”可不标注,但专业或不常见的缩写应使用abbr标签以增强清晰度和专业性;6. 团队可维护缩写词列表以确保全站一致性和可访问性标准。使用abbr标签是提升网页语义化、可访问性与用户体验的有效实践。

abbr

在我看来,
abbr
<abbr>
title
比如说,你可能写到“CSS”,对于一个初学者或者非技术背景的用户来说,这可能只是三个字母。但如果你写成:

<p>学习 <abbr title="层叠样式表">CSS</abbr> 是网页开发的基础。</p>
那么当用户把鼠标悬停在“CSS”上时,就会看到“层叠样式表”的完整解释。这种体验,无论是对普通用户还是使用辅助技术的用户,都是一种巨大的便利。它避免了在正文中反复解释缩写词的冗余,同时又确保了信息的完整性。我觉得这种设计哲学挺巧妙的,它鼓励我们把内容做得更精细,而不是一股脑地堆砌信息。
讲真,很多人可能觉得一个简单的缩写词解释,有那么重要吗?但从用户体验和技术规范的角度看,这事儿还真挺关键的。首先是可访问性,这是我个人特别看重的一点。想象一下,如果一个视力受损的用户正在使用屏幕阅读器浏览你的网站,当他遇到“NASA”或者“HTTP”这样的缩写词时,如果没有
abbr
abbr

其次,这关系到内容的清晰度和专业性。一个网站如果充斥着各种没有解释的缩写,会让读者感到困惑,甚至觉得你的内容不够严谨。而合理使用
abbr
abbr
这是一个老生常谈的问题了,也挺有意思的。早些年,HTML规范里确实有两个标签来处理缩写词:
abbr
acronym
abbr
acronym
然而,随着HTML5的到来,这种区分被废弃了。现在,答案很明确:acronym
abbr
acronym
abbr
在实际项目中,有效地运用
abbr
abbr
title
title
abbr
其次,为了让用户更容易发现这些可悬停解释的缩写词,通常会配合CSS进行一些样式上的处理。最常见的就是给
abbr
abbr {
border-bottom: 1px dotted; /* 虚线下划线 */
cursor: help; /* 鼠标悬停时显示帮助光标 */
}这样一来,用户在浏览页面时,一眼就能看出哪些词是缩写,并且可以通过悬停来获取更多信息。这是一种很棒的视觉提示,提升了交互性。
再来聊聊使用场景。不是所有的缩写词都需要用
abbr
abbr
abbr
最后,在大型项目中,为了保持一致性,团队内部可以维护一个常用的缩写词列表,并规定哪些缩写词需要使用
abbr
以上就是abbr标签的用途是什么?缩写词如何解释?的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号